Issue: Super Citizen Status Not Appearing
If you have purchased the Super Citizen Edition or the Upgrade pack and your status, or associated bonuses like the Steeled Veterans Warbond, have not appeared after several hours of gameplay, you are not alone. This is a known issue affecting some players.
Solution:
- Continue playing the game. Some players have reported the status appearing after several hours and restarting the game.
- Ensure you have purchased the correct edition or upgrade pack from the PlayStation Store or Steam.
- If the issue persists, it is likely a server-side problem that Arrowhead Game Studios will address in future patches.
Issue: Matchmaking Problems
Players may experience difficulties connecting to games or finding lobbies.
Solution:
- Ensure your game is updated to the latest version.
- Restart your game and your internet router.
- Check the Helldivers 2 server status online or on social media for any ongoing outages.
- Try joining friends directly if matchmaking fails.
Issue: Controls Not Responding / Input Lag
Some players may encounter issues with their controls not registering or experiencing input lag, especially when playing with strangers online.
Solution:
- PC Controls for Pinging/Marking:
- Ping Location: Look at the objective/enemy and press Q.
- Mark Location on Minimap: Press Tab to open the minimap, hold the right mouse button, move the mouse to the desired area, and click the left mouse button to place a marker.
- PS5 Controls for Pinging/Marking:
- Ping Location: Press R1 + D-Pad Up.
- Mark Location on Minimap: Open the minimap via the touchpad, navigate with the joystick, and press the Cross button to mark.
- Ensure your controller is properly connected.
- Update your controller drivers if playing on PC.
- If experiencing lag, check your internet connection and consider a wired connection if possible.
Issue: Friendly Fire causing chaos
Friendly fire is enabled in Helldivers 2, which can lead to accidental team kills, especially in chaotic firefights.
Solution:
- Communicate with your team using pings or voice chat to coordinate actions and avoid friendly fire incidents.
- Be mindful of your surroundings and the positioning of your teammates when using heavy weapons or explosives.
- Utilize the minimap to track teammate locations and potential hazards.
